Holidays To Shizuoka
Dreaming of a calm hillside getaway in Japan? Well, holidays in Shizuoka sound like the perfect idea. In fact, that’s exactly what the name “Shizuoka” means—calm hill.
Of course, there’s more to this seaside escape than a rolling landscape. Located about 175 km southwest of Tokyo, Shizuoka is home to unique museums, outdoor adventures and views of Mount Fuji. You can easily extend Shizuoka holidays with a day trip out to the famous volcano—just load up on delicious coastal cuisine first!
Things to Do in Shizuoka
As the capital of Shizuoka Prefecture, this waterfront city is a snapshot of the best of the region. You can take a few snaps of your own at Miho Seacoast, a beach east of the port. It may be on the edge of an urban jungle, but you can still don your bathers and take a peaceful swim!
From the beach you’re just a short walk out to the end of harbour, where you can make some finned friends at Tokai University Marine Science Museum. You’ll want to dry off for a tour of the Shizuoka castle ruins, though—they were quite fancy back in the 16th century. There in old city centre, northwest of the waterfront, you can get to know the local culture by sight at the Shizuoka City Museum of Art, or by taste with a traditional tea service in Sunpujo Park.

Shopping, Dining & Nightlife

Not one for the conventional buying experience? Well, at S-Pulse Dream Plaza, you can shop till you almost drop, hop on a Ferris wheel, and shop some more! We kid you not—there is a hybrid shopping centre and amusement park on the west side of the harbour, and it’s fabulous .
As with the shopping scenes, dining in Shizuoka is centred around Sunpujo Park and the port. Both neighbourhoods whip up amazing seafood and fresh fish, including sushi that rivals Tokyo’s bigger restaurants. Shizuoka Prefecture is also known for its gourmet grilling. Try the grilled unagi, a freshwater eel that’s marinated in tasty soy sauce. Mmm.
The nightlife can be pretty quiet near the waterfront, where dinner turns into hours of conversation. But if you wander further inland toward the old city, you’ll find heaps of dance clubs with visiting DJs ready to spin some tunes under neon lights.
